When evaluating Melanotan 2 vendors for Vladimir Oblast shipping, three verification steps cover most of the relevant risk: verify peer standing in research communities, verify that the COA for your batch is accessible and complete, and verify confirmed shipping history to Vladimir Oblast. The COA verification step that Vladimir Oblast researchers frequently overlook is checking that the COA batch number matches the product batch number on the vial received — a COA is only meaningful when it is specific to the exact lot in hand. Storage infrastructure is a practical consideration Vladimir Oblast researchers should prepare before sourcing Melanotan 2 — lyophilised peptides require freezer-temperature storage at −20°C, and ordering large quantities without proper storage in place is counterproductive to research quality. Frequently Asked Questions

What is Melanotan-2?

Melanotan-2 (MT-2) is a cyclic analogue of alpha-melanocyte-stimulating hormone (α-MSH) with modifications that increase potency and half-life compared to native α-MSH. It acts on multiple melanocortin receptors including MC1R (pigmentation), MC3R and MC4R (CNS effects). It is a research compound studied for melanocortin receptor pharmacology.

How is Melanotan-2 stored?

Lyophilized MT-2 should be stored at −20°C away from light (UV degrades the peptide). Once reconstituted, it should be kept refrigerated at 2-8°C in an amber or light-protected vial, and used within 30 days. MT-2 is sensitive to UV exposure, so minimize light contact during reconstitution and handling.

What are the main receptor targets of Melanotan-2?

MT-2 is a relatively non-selective melanocortin receptor agonist with activity at MC1R (melanocyte pigmentation stimulation), MC3R (CNS, energy homeostasis), MC4R (CNS, appetite/libido-related effects), and some activity at MC5R. This broad receptor activity profile means it has multiple simultaneous effects in research models.
